Tamesis Dock is where London becomes pure riverside eccentric charm, a place that feels like discovering a floating pocket of the city's bohemian soul, anchored gently on the Thames.
Set right on the South Bank near Vauxhall, Tamesis Dock is not your typical bar or pub experience, it is literally a boat, a moored vessel turned into one of London's most beloved alternative hangouts. The moment you arrive, you feel the difference: the river air, the slight sway beneath your feet, the sense that you've stepped into something playful and unexpected. London can often feel grand and imposing, but Tamesis Dock feels intimate, lived-in, creative, the kind of place where the city loosens up. The atmosphere is warm and eclectic, with mismatched furniture, string lights, music drifting through the air, and a crowd that feels distinctly South Bank: artists, locals, travelers, friends gathering for sunset drinks with the river as their backdrop. Behind Tamesis Dock's quirky floating charm lies a deeper story about London's relationship with the Thames as a living social space, not just a historic river.
Many visitors don't realize how much the Thames still shapes London's culture beyond sightseeing, offering spaces where people gather, drink, and live beside the water. Tamesis Dock embodies that spirit, turning a boat into a community venue that feels creative and welcoming rather than commercial. The bar has become known for its relaxed, alternative energy, often hosting live music, events, and evenings that feel spontaneous. Its location near Vauxhall places it slightly outside the most tourist-heavy South Bank stretch, making it feel more local, more discovered.
